Eugenol Inhibits ATP-induced P2X Currents in Trigeminal Ganglion Neurons
HaiYingLi, ByungKyLee, JoongSooKim, SungJunJung, SeogBaeOh 대한생리학회-대한약리학회 The Korean Journal of Physiology & Pharmacology 8 Pages
대한생리학회-대한약리학회 The Korean Journal of Physiology & Pharmacology 2008, Vol.12 No.6 5 315-322 (8 pages)
Eugenol is widely used in dentistry to relieve pain. We have recently demonstrated voltage-gated Na+ and Ca2+ channels as molecular targets for its analgesic effects, and hypothesized that eugenol acts on P2X3, another pain receptor expressed in trigeminal ganglion (TG), and tested the effects of eugenol by whole-cell patch clamp and Ca2+ imaging techniques. Effects of Somatostatin on the Responses of Rostrally Projecting Spinal Dorsal Horn Neurons to Noxious Stimuli in Cats
SungJunJung, Su-HyunJo, SanghyuckLee, EunhuiOh, Min-SeokKim, WooDongNam, SeogBaeOh 대한생리학회-대한약리학회 The Korean Journal of Physiology & Pharmacology 6 Pages
대한생리학회-대한약리학회 The Korean Journal of Physiology & Pharmacology 2008, Vol.12 No.5 6 253-258 (6 pages)
Somatostatin (SOM) is a widely distributed peptide in the central nervous system and exerts a variety of hormonal and neural actions. Although SOM is assumed to play an important role in spinal nociceptive processing, its exact function remains unclear. In fact, earlier pharmacological studies have provided results that support either a facilitatory or inhibitory role for SOM in nociception. Neuroprotective Effects of Lithium on NMDA-induced Excitotoxicity in Mouse Cerebrum
Gee-younKwon, Soo-kyungKim 대한생리학회-대한약리학회 The Korean Journal of Physiology & Pharmacology 12 Pages
대한생리학회-대한약리학회 The Korean Journal of Physiology & Pharmacology 2006, Vol.10 No.3 1 111-122 (12 pages)
Neuroprotective properties of lithium were evaluated by using in vivo NMDA excitotoxicity model. Calcium Ion Dynamics after Dexamethasone Treatment in Organotypic Cultured Hippocampal Slice
Hee-JungChae, Tong-HoKang, Ji-HoPark 대한생리학회-대한약리학회 The Korean Journal of Physiology & Pharmacology 8 Pages
대한생리학회-대한약리학회 The Korean Journal of Physiology & Pharmacology 2005, Vol.9 No.6 8 363-370 (8 pages)
It is imperative to analyse brain injuries directly in real time, so as to find effective therapeutic compounds to protect brain injuries by stress. We established a system which could elucidate the real time Ca2 dynamics in an organotypic cultured hippocampal slice by the insults of artificial stress hormone, dexamethasone. YS 49, a Synthetic Isoquinoline Alkaloid, Protects Sheep Pulmonary Artery Endothelial Cells from tert-butylhydroperoxide-mediated Cytotoxicity
WonSeogChong, SunYoungKang, YoungJinKang, MinKyuPark, YoungSooLee, HyeJungKim, HanGeukSeo, JaeHeunLee, HyeSookYun-Choi, KiChurlChang 대한생리학회-대한약리학회 The Korean Journal of Physiology & Pharmacology 8 Pages
대한생리학회-대한약리학회 The Korean Journal of Physiology & Pharmacology 2005, Vol.9 No.5 5 283-290 (8 pages)
Endothelium, particularly pulmonary endothelium, is predisposed to injury by reactive oxygen species (ROS) and their derivatives. Heme oxygenase (HO) has been demonstrated to provide cytoprotective effects in models of oxidant-induced cellular and tissue injuries. In the present study, we investigated the effects of YS 49 against oxidant [tert-butylhydroperoxide (TBH)]-induced injury using cultured sheep pulmonary artery endothelial cells (SPAECs). Inhibition of Hypoxia-induced Apoptosis in PC12 Cells by Estradiol
JiYeonJung, KwangHoonRoh, YeonJinJeong, SunHunKim, EunJuLee, MinSeokKim, WonMannOh, HeeKyunOh, WonJaeKim 대한생리학회-대한약리학회 The Korean Journal of Physiology & Pharmacology 8 Pages
대한생리학회-대한약리학회 The Korean Journal of Physiology & Pharmacology 2005, Vol.9 No.4 7 231-238 (8 pages)
Neuronal apoptotic events, which result in cell death, are occurred in hypoxic/ischemic conditions. Estradiol is a female sex hormone with steroid structure known to provide neuroprotection through multiple mechanisms in the central nervous system. This study was aimed to investigate the signal transduction pathway of CoCl2-induced neuronal cell death and the inhibitory effects of estradiol. The Effect of External Divalent Cations on Intestinal Pacemaking Activity
ByungJooKim, KiWhanKim 대한생리학회-대한약리학회 The Korean Journal of Physiology & Pharmacology 6 Pages
대한생리학회-대한약리학회 The Korean Journal of Physiology & Pharmacology 2005, Vol.9 No.4 3 203-208 (6 pages)
Electrical rhythmicity in the gastrointestinal (GI) muscles is generated by pacemaker cells, known as interstitial cells of Cajal (ICC). In the present study, we investigated the effect of external divalent cations on pacemaking activity in cultured ICC from murine small intestine by using whole-cell patch clamp techniques. Na+-Ca2+ Exchange Curtails Ca2+ before Its Diffusion to Global Ca2+i in the Rat Ventricular Myocyte
Sung-WanAhnChangMannKo 대한생리학회-대한약리학회 The Korean Journal of Physiology & Pharmacology 8 Pages
대한생리학회-대한약리학회 The Korean Journal of Physiology & Pharmacology 2005, Vol.9 No.2 4 95-102 (8 pages)
In the heart, Na-Ca2 exchange (NCX) is the major Ca2 extrusion mechanism. NCX has been considered as a relaxation mechanism, as it reduces global [Ca2]i raised during activation. However, if NCX locates in the close proximity to the ryanodine receptor, then NCX would curtail Ca2 before its diffusion to global Ca2i.
